What does the Bible say about coming to Christ as a child?

Answered in 1 source

The Bible teaches that we must receive the kingdom of God like little children to enter it (Luke 18:17).

In Luke 18:15-17, Jesus emphasizes that one must receive the kingdom of God like a little child. This means approaching Christ with humility, recognizing our neediness, and depending entirely on His grace rather than our own understanding or efforts. Children are unpretentious and do not pretend to have it all figured out; this is how we are to come to Christ—fully aware of our helplessness and needing His salvation without any pretense of merit.
Scripture References: Luke 18:15-17
